Group applauds Chiemeka’s appointment as NGX CEO

The Securities and Investment Empowerment Network has expressed its enthusiastic endorsement of the Nigerian Exchange Limited’s decision to appoint Jude Chiemeka as its substantive Chief Executive Officer.
In a statement released on Monday and obtained by our correspondent, the Securities and Investment Empowerment Network, a professional organization in the finance sector, praised the appointment of Jude Chiemeka as CEO of the Nigerian Exchange Limited, noting that his leadership is likely to foster increased market growth.
The Nigerian Exchange Group recently announced the appointment of Jude Chiemeka as Chief Executive Officer of the exchange, a move that received regulatory approval from the Securities and Exchange Commission.
Before then, he had been leading the NGX in an acting capacity.
SIEN’s President, Dr Albert Ogunseyinde, stated that Chiemeka’s extensive experience provides him with a deep understanding of the complexities of the financial markets and the strategic vision needed to navigate them.
“Chiemeka’s appointment as CEO of NGX is a testament to his exceptional leadership abilities and extensive industry experience. His deep understanding of the financial markets, coupled with his strategic acumen, makes him the ideal person to lead NGX into a new era of growth and innovation.
“His amiable leadership style, characterised by a commitment to excellence and a focus on stakeholder engagement, has earned him a reputation as a transformative leader. His previous roles have demonstrated his ability to drive organisational change, enhance operational efficiency, and foster a culture of transparency, accountability and empathy,” he said.
Before his current role, Chiemeka was the Executive Director of Capital Markets at the exchange.
SIEN added that with Chiemeka’s resume, the NGX was expected to undergo significant advancements under his leadership.
“Chiemeka’s vision for NGX aligns with the broader objectives of positioning the exchange as a leading player in the global financial markets. The Nigerian Exchange Limited plays a crucial role in the nation’s economic development by facilitating capital formation and promoting investment opportunities.
With Chiemeka at the helm, we are confident that NGX will continue to contribute significantly to the growth and diversification of Nigeria’s economy,” said Ogunseyinde.
Jude Chiemeka, a distinguished professional in the financial industry, holds esteemed memberships and fellowships with several prestigious organizations, including the Chartered Institute of Stockbrokers, where he serves on the Council, as well as the Institute of Directors and the Chartered Institute for Securities & Investment in the United Kingdom.
